3M™ Glass Bubbles iM16K 3M Advanced Materials Division 3M™ Glass Bubbles iM16K are hollow glass spheres with a typical density of 0.46 g/cc and an isostatic crush strength of 16,000 psi. 3M™ Glass Bubbles are lightweight hollow glass microspheres with a broad range of densities, particle sizes and crush stre...view more 3M™ Glass Bubbles iM16K are hollow glass spheres with a typical density of 0.46 g/cc and an isostatic crush strength of 16,000 psi. 3M™ Glass Bubbles are lightweight hollow glass microspheres with a broad range of densities, particle sizes and crush strengths. These general purpose spheres offer very good strength-to-density ratio and making them suitable for a variety of uses in the paints and coatings industry. These microspheres are used in applications from specialty architectural and industrial paints to lightweight spackling, caulks, adhesives and roof coatings. Manufacturers use 3M glass bubbles for their ability to help reduce weight, improve reflectivity, reduce shrinkage, enhance surface appearance and help reduce overall material costs. view less

C Glass Flake GF007/C Glassflake Ltd C Glass Flake GF007/C is a corrosion resistant glass flake which is manufactured from modified C glass with a nominal thickness of Av. 5 +/- 2 microns. The manufacturing process utilized by this flake differs from the normal spun-glass method, resulting in a wider thickness specification. Primarily used in anti-corrosive coatings, glass flakes can be used to improve both barrier properties and reinforcement of mechanical properties, giving the finished product an isotropic reinforcement across the plane of the platelet. Glassflake materials are offered with the option of surface pre-treatment with a range of saline coupling agents including; 3-Aminopropyltriethoxy Saline, Vinyl trimethoxy Saline, γ-Glycidoxypropyltrimethoxy Saline and Methacryloxypropyltrimethoxy Saline. view less

SpaceRite® S-3 Alumina Trihydrate Huber Engineered Materials SpaceRite® S-3 is a fine crystalline, aluminum trihydroxide with uniform particles averaging about one micron in diameter. It is an organic-free pure white powder produced by a proprietary precipitation process that closely controls particle-size distributions. SpaceRite S-3 can also replace other extenders providing enhanced performance and benefits in coatings and adhesives. SpaceRite S-3 has many uses in architectural coatings and high solids/low VOC coatings. view less
